Fixed bug #1011 Daniel Ellis 2010-06-25 15:20:31 PDT SDL based applications sometimes display the wrong application name in the Sound Preferences dialog when using pulseaudio. I can see from the code that the SDL pulse module is initiating a new pulse audio context and passing an application name using the function get_progname(). The get_progname() function returns the name of the current process. However, the process name is often not a suitable name to use. For example, the OpenShot video editor is a python application, and so "python" is displayed in the Sound Preferences window (see Bug #596504), when it should be displaying "OpenShot". PulseAudio allows applications to specify the application name, either at the time the context is created (as SDL does currently), or by special environment variables (see http://www.pulseaudio.org/wiki/ApplicationProperties). If no name is specified, then pulseaudio will determine the name based on the process. If you specify the application name when initiating the pulseaudio context, then that will override any application name specified using an environment variable. As libsdl is a library, I believe the solution is for libsdl to not specify any application name when initiating a pulseaudio context, which will enable applications to specify the application name using environment variables. In the case that the applications do not specify anything, pulseaudio will fall back to using the process name anyway. The attached patch removes the get_progname() function and passes NULL as the application name when creating the pulseaudio context, which fixes the issue.

#include "SDL_config.h"

#include "SDL_ps3video.h"

void
PS3_InitModes(_THIS)
{
    deprintf(1, "+PS3_InitModes()\n");
    SDL_VideoDisplay display;
    SDL_VideoData *data = (SDL_VideoData *) _this->driverdata;
    SDL_DisplayMode mode;
    PS3_DisplayModeData *modedata;
    unsigned long vid = 0;

    modedata = (PS3_DisplayModeData *) SDL_malloc(sizeof(*modedata));
    if (!modedata) {
        return;
    }

    /* Setting up the DisplayMode based on current settings */
    struct ps3fb_ioctl_res res;
    if (ioctl(data->fbdev, PS3FB_IOCTL_SCREENINFO, &res)) {
        SDL_SetError("Can't get PS3FB_IOCTL_SCREENINFO");
    }
    mode.format = SDL_PIXELFORMAT_RGB888;
    mode.refresh_rate = 0;
    mode.w = res.xres;
    mode.h = res.yres;

    /* Setting up driver specific mode data,
     * Get the current ps3 specific videmode number */
    if (ioctl(data->fbdev, PS3FB_IOCTL_GETMODE, (unsigned long)&vid)) {
        SDL_SetError("Can't get PS3FB_IOCTL_GETMODE");
    }
    deprintf(2, "PS3FB_IOCTL_GETMODE = %u\n", vid);
    modedata->mode = vid;
    mode.driverdata = modedata;

    /* Set display's videomode and add it */
    SDL_zero(display);
    display.desktop_mode = mode;
    display.current_mode = mode;

    SDL_AddVideoDisplay(&display);
    deprintf(1, "-PS3_InitModes()\n");
}

/* DisplayModes available on the PS3 */
static SDL_DisplayMode ps3fb_modedb[] = {
    /* VESA */
    {SDL_PIXELFORMAT_RGB888, 1280, 768, 0, NULL}, // WXGA
    {SDL_PIXELFORMAT_RGB888, 1280, 1024, 0, NULL}, // SXGA
    {SDL_PIXELFORMAT_RGB888, 1920, 1200, 0, NULL}, // WUXGA
    /* Native resolutions (progressive, "fullscreen") */
    {SDL_PIXELFORMAT_RGB888, 720, 480, 0, NULL}, // 480p
    {SDL_PIXELFORMAT_RGB888, 1280, 720, 0, NULL}, // 720p
    {SDL_PIXELFORMAT_RGB888, 1920, 1080, 0, NULL} // 1080p
};

/* PS3 videomode number according to ps3fb_modedb */
static PS3_DisplayModeData ps3fb_data[] = {
    {11}, {12}, {13}, {130}, {131}, {133}, 
};

void
PS3_GetDisplayModes(_THIS, SDL_VideoDisplay * display)
{
    deprintf(1, "+PS3_GetDisplayModes()\n");
    SDL_DisplayMode mode;
    unsigned int nummodes;

    nummodes = sizeof(ps3fb_modedb) / sizeof(SDL_DisplayMode);

    int n;
    for (n=0; n<nummodes; ++n) {
        /* Get driver specific mode data */
        ps3fb_modedb[n].driverdata = &ps3fb_data[n];

        /* Add DisplayMode to list */
        deprintf(2, "Adding resolution %u x %u\n", ps3fb_modedb[n].w, ps3fb_modedb[n].h);
        SDL_AddDisplayMode(display, &ps3fb_modedb[n]);
    }
    deprintf(1, "-PS3_GetDisplayModes()\n");
}

int
PS3_SetDisplayMode(_THIS, SDL_VideoDisplay * display, SDL_DisplayMode * mode)
{
    deprintf(1, "+PS3_SetDisplayMode()\n");
    SDL_VideoData *data = (SDL_VideoData *) _this->driverdata;
    PS3_DisplayModeData *dispdata = (PS3_DisplayModeData *) mode->driverdata;

    /* Set the new DisplayMode */
    deprintf(2, "Setting PS3FB_MODE to %u\n", dispdata->mode);
    if (ioctl(data->fbdev, PS3FB_IOCTL_SETMODE, (unsigned long)&dispdata->mode)) {
        deprintf(2, "Could not set PS3FB_MODE\n");
        SDL_SetError("Could not set PS3FB_MODE\n");
        return -1;
    }

    deprintf(1, "-PS3_SetDisplayMode()\n");
    return 0;
}

void
PS3_QuitModes(_THIS)
{
    deprintf(1, "+PS3_QuitModes()\n");

    /* There was no mem allocated for driverdata */
    int i, j;
    for (i = 0; i < SDL_GetNumVideoDisplays(); ++i) {
        SDL_VideoDisplay *display = SDL_GetVideoDisplay(i);
        for (j = display->num_display_modes; j--;) {
            display->display_modes[j].driverdata = NULL;
        }
    }

    deprintf(1, "-PS3_QuitModes()\n");
}
